Armed militants reportedly attacked the village of Ncole in Cabo Delgado province, Mozambique on April 3, 2025, forcing residents to flee after burning homes and killing at least one civilian. The incident follows the pattern of insurgent violence that has plagued northern Mozambique's gas-rich region since 2017.
